Two separate men reported missing from Nanaimo area

Share

RCMP are asking the public for help to locate two different people who have been reported missing from the Nanaimo area.

The first man, Shadoe Lake, was reported missing by his grandmother, who resides in Newfoundland.

She told police that her 29-year-old grandson lives a transient, high-risk lifestyle and she is concerned for his wellbeing.

Lake is known to travel between Oceanside and Nanaimo and has frequented homeless shelters in both areas. He is described as a white male, 6 feet tall with a slim build, blonde hair and blue eyes.

Another Nanaimo man, Matthew Santoro, was reported missing to the RCMP on June 29, 2021. His family told police they last heard from him on May 21, 2021.

Investigators searched for 34-year-old Santoro with extensive patrols throughout Nanaimo, but have been unable to locate him. They are also following up on a lead that he may have travelled to the mainland.

Santoro is described as a white male, 5 feet 7 inches tall, approximately 160 pounds, with short brown hair and brown eyes.

Anyone with information on the whereabouts of Shadoe Lake or Matthew Santoro is asked to contact the Nanaimo RCMP non-emergency line at 250-754-2345.

For information on Shadoe Lake, file #2021-24887 should be quoted.

For information on Matthew Santoro, file #2021-23871 should be quoted.
